Improved technology, including the application of electronic components, led to the development of a new generation of air suspension systems for passenger cars. These systems have now been introduced into the marketplace. The reasons for air suspension systems, the design criteria of their components and their control will be described. Details will be given of the air supply-unit compressor + air dryer), of the air distribution components (pipes, valves) and control components sensors, electronic control unit).
